Quite an education. I knew there was a Pittsburgh black renaissance in a general sense, but hearing all the names and accomplishments across music, sports, and perhaps most impressively journalism, really put things into perspective. Then, while the renaissance had already begun to wane, the city decided to demolish the community that created it to build an arena.
